Transaction db1cedaba904ea66c5c6f616e3e3ddaef8ce7618efd65613b391b06e8ed9903e
1 Input
1 Output
-
db1cedaba904ea66c5c6f616e3e3ddaef8ce7618efd65613b391b06e8ed9903e:0
- value
- 89959895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4befe1c25f227ea0c3cc9669b92c8af0ff425e6e OP_EQUAL
- address
- 38cXyDTtpM325wfCZXyiiD7Z8xhtY5ncGG